The Versatility of DTF Printers

One of the most significant advantages of DTF printers is their versatility. These printers are designed to print on virtually any type of fabric, including cotton, polyester, nylon, leather, and fabric blends. This broad fabric compatibility sets DTF printers apart from other printing technologies like DTG printers, which are limited to printing on cotton-based materials. Whether you’re printing on light-colored fabrics or dark textiles, DTF printers produce vibrant, durable designs that appeal to a wide customer base.

Wide Range of Applications

From custom t-shirts and hoodies to promotional items like bags and caps, DTF printing allows businesses to print on diverse materials. This flexibility enables companies to cater to various industries, such as fashion, sportswear, and promotional products, expanding their product offerings. The ability to print on polyester, nylon, and leatheropens up new possibilities for custom garment printing, enabling businesses to explore niche markets and meet customer demand for specialized products.

Durability of Prints

In the competitive world of custom garment printing, durability is a key factor for success. DTF printers produce prints that are highly resistant to cracking, fading, and peeling. Unlike traditional printing methods, such as screen printing or DTG printing, DTF prints can withstand multiple washes without losing their vibrant colors or crisp details. This durability is thanks to the DTF printing process, which utilizes heat transfer technology combined with an adhesive layer that bonds the ink to the fabric. The result is a long-lasting, high-quality print that can withstand everyday wear and tear.

Assess the Current State of the Property

I check the unfinished house for safety and structural integrity. Framed houses sometimes need more drywall, plumbing, or electrical systems to be livable. I walk the site looking for issues that may impact property value or curb appeal.

I note if there is missing framing, broken windows, exposed wires, or water leaks. Many properties get stuck due to rising prices of materials or unexpected expenses. I see examples where owners have faced life changes or contractor delays.

I make a detailed list showing what work is done and what still needs attention: electrical, plumbing, roofing, and other key areas. Permitted work should match building permits with documents ready for buyers under the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A).

Gathering inspection reports helps spot problems early; reports from a licensed home inspector can show hidden issues buyers worry about in today’s real estate market. Real estate agents guide me on how each step might affect my pricing strategy and expenses before planning my marketing plan with confidence.

Determine the Market Value of the Incomplete Property

I start with the basics. I check the current state of the unfinished house. I list what work is done and what is left to finish. Some things, like completed plumbing or wiring, can increase market value fast.

Renovation costs matter a lot; if it will take $50,000 more to finish compared to similar listings, that amount impacts price right away.

Real estate agents help me study comparable properties, also called comps. These are other homes sold nearby in similar condition—complete or incomplete—in the local real estate market over the last 6 months.

Location has a big effect too; houses near good schools or shopping usually get higher offers.

I consult a licensed appraiser if needed; some appraisers price new builds as though finished per plan but then subtract for incomplete jobs line by line. This method gives buyers clarity on how my ask fits fair market value and highlights renovation costs up front.

Setting an “as-is” asking price means being realistic about demand and adjusting for both visible curb appeal and hidden investment needs. Next, I focus on how I highlight possibilities for customization and growth to attract serious buyers searching for options in this unique niche.

Consider Offering Flexible Financing Options for Buyers

Seller financing and renovation loans attract more buyers in the real estate market. Most banks only give loans if an unfinished house is livable, so flexible offers help. I let buyers know about construction or renovation loan options from lenders like Wells Fargo and FHA 203(k).

Seller financing lets me act as the bank for a set period, making deals possible even when standard mortgages do not fit.

Some buyers want to buy “subject to completion.” They finish the building project after closing, which suits investors and house flippers who plan their own upgrades. Flexible terms open doors for people with different budgets or those ready to handle work permits and renovation costs on their timeline.

These choices expand my marketing strategy by reaching more serious leads fast.

Set a Competitive “As-Is” Price and Leave Room for Negotiation

I set my “as-is” price by checking the current state of the unfinished house, local comps, and recent sales data. I consider repair costs and buyer demand in the real estate market.

Investors expect a significant discount on an incomplete property; often 20% to 30% less than finished homes nearby. I keep curb appeal and renovation costs in mind too.

I aim low enough to attract attention but high enough for room to negotiate. For example, if completed houses sell at $400,000, I might list mine at $300,000 or $320,000 based on needed work and building permits status.

This smart pricing strategy lets me adjust during talks with house flippers or investors without leaving money behind.

Prepare the Property for Showings

I always make sure the place looks safe and tidy for anyone visiting—a clean site boosts curb appeal. I keep all paperwork handy, like building permits and lists of finished work, so buyers can check everything before making a choice.

Clean and Secure the Site

I sweep all floors, pick up trash, and remove loose tools. Safety comes first. I fix any exposed wires or sharp edges, and block off unsafe areas with tape or orange cones, so buyers can walk the unfinished house safely.

I check for open pits, unstable stairs, or missing railings—these are clear hazards.

Locks stay on doors and windows; only licensed agents get keys during showings. My focus is legal compliance too; every building permit hangs in sight to show work meets codes. Open paths help boost curb appeal for real estate market photos—buyers see a site that feels cared for even if construction is not done yet.

Next up: I organize documents that prove which parts of the property are finished and safe.

Organize Documentation of Completed Work

Once the site is clean and safe, I pull together all paperwork for buyers. I keep building permits in a folder, so they see the unfinished house meets code. Inspection reports go next; these show that work done so far follows real estate market rules and carries no big risks.

Completed contractor agreements list each finished job, like roof framing or electrical wiring.

I add up-to-date cost estimates from trusted builders—buyers want to know what remains before moving in. Having 4 main documents ready—building permits, inspection reports, contractor agreements, and cost estimates—increases buyer confidence.

I use cloud tools like DocuSign or Google Drive for quick sharing during showings or offers. Organized records save time at closing and prove my property stands out among incomplete listings.

The Rise of Data-Driven Marketing

Data-driven marketing is not just another buzzword; it’s a paradigm shift in how marketing campaigns are conceptualised, executed, and measured. By leveraging data, companies can optimise their marketing efforts for maximum efficiency and effectiveness. The capability to track customer interactions provides businesses with insights that can drastically improve their marketing tactics.

Data-driven initiatives can lead to a greater understanding of consumer behaviour, enabling businesses to tailor their offerings and messages to better suit their target audience. This hyper-personalisation can significantly enhance the customer experience and foster brand loyalty.

Understanding Your Audience

One of the key components of data-driven marketing is the ability to understand and segment your audience. Utilising data analytics tools, you can uncover patterns and trends in your customer’s behaviours. This knowledge allows for the creation of targeted campaigns that resonate with different segments, increasing the likelihood of conversion and reducing wasted ad spend on uninterested parties.

In addition to segmentation, businesses can use their data to predict future trends and customer needs, placing them one step ahead of the competition. Predictive analytics can forecast potential market changes, giving your company the chance to adjust strategies proactively rather than reactively.

Driving Customer Retention

While acquiring new customers is essential, retaining existing ones is equally, if not more, vital for sustaining growth. Data-driven strategies enhance customer retention rates by providing insights into customer satisfaction and engagement levels. Tools like the Pendula BI suite enable businesses to gauge the effectiveness of their customer retention strategies and take data-informed actions to improve them.

Retention-focused platforms can identify patterns in customer attrition and help businesses develop targeted campaigns to re-engage lapsed customers. By understanding the reasons behind customer churn, companies can implement measures to prevent it, ensuring a stable and loyal customer base.

Continuous Optimisation

Data-driven marketing is an iterative process where continuous optimisation is crucial. Through the use of analytics, businesses can test different approaches, measure results, and refine their campaigns for better performance. This method of ongoing improvement ensures that marketing efforts remain relevant and effective over time.

Additionally, A/B testing and multivariate testing are facilitated by data-centric marketing, allowing businesses to make informed decisions based on empirical evidence rather than guesswork. The rigorous, scientific approach enabled by data can significantly enhance the efficiency of marketing resources.
